Clearing work starts April 5 for US-2 Crystal Falls project

April 1, 2010

CRYSTAL FALLS — The Michigan Department of Transportation (MDOT) will be reconstructing and widening a section of US-2 in Crystal Falls to extend the center left-turn lane, installing new curb and gutter, and building an enclosed storm sewer. The project also includes construction of a nonmotorized trail from Park Street to the Iron County Medical Facility.

 

Construction will begin April 5 and should be completed by Sept. 16. This project will require lane closures with flag control.
